Nacos指南-服务发现:删除服务
删除服务
- API
- 描述
- 请求类型
- 请求路径
- 请求参数
- 错误编码
- 示例请求
- 示例返回
- 总结
API
描述
删除一个服务,只有当服务下实例数为0时允许删除
请求类型
DELETE
请求路径
/nacos/v1/ns/service
请求参数
名称 | 类型 | 是否必选 | 描述 |
---|---|---|---|
serviceName | 字符串 | 是 | 服务名 |
groupName | 字符串 | 否 | 分组名 |
namespaceId | 字符串 | 否 | 命名空间ID |
错误编码
错误代码 | 描述 | 语义 |
---|---|---|
400 | Bad Request | 客户端请求中的语法错误 |
403 | Forbidden | 没有权限 |
404 | Not Found | 无法找到资源 |
500 | Internal Server Error | 服务器内部错误 |
200 | OK | 正常 |
示例请求
curl -X DELETE '127.0.0.1:8848/nacos/v1/ns/service?serviceName=nacos.test.2'
示例返回
ok
总结
虽然文档给出的描述是只有当服务下实例数为0时允许删除,但是实际上并没有强制检查校验服务下的实例数是否为0。Nacos的服务创建有多种方式,可以主动创建可以在注册实例的时候创建,可以在实例发送心跳时创建,所以哪怕主动删除了还会自动创建回来。
Nacos指南-服务发现:删除服务相关推荐
- 基于gRPC服务发现与服务治理的方案
重温最少化集群搭建,我相信很多朋友都已经搭建出来,基于Watch机制也实现了出来,相信也有很多朋友有了自己的实现思路,但是,很多朋友有个疑问,我API和服务分离好了,怎么通过服务中心进行发现呢,这个过 ...
- Spring Cloud【Finchley】-02服务发现与服务注册Eureka + Eureka Server的搭建
文章目录 服务发现组件概述 Eureka概述 Eureka原理 Maven父子工程的搭建 Eureka Server的搭建 新建 Maven Module 添加spring-cloud-starter ...
- 学习搭建 Consul 服务发现与服务网格-有丰富的示例和图片
第一部分:Consul 基础 1,Consul 介绍 官网文档描述:Consul 是一个网络工具,提供功能齐全的服务网格和服务发现. 它可以做什么:自动化网络配置,发现服务并启用跨任何云或运行时的安全 ...
- 干货实操:微服务Spring Cloud 系列(二) Eureka服务发现与服务注册(strand alone)
此篇主要实操Eureka 服务端的服务注册,以及服务发现,并需要认证才能访问控制中心. 分五个部分说明: 一. 认识 Eureka 二. Eureka 服务端开发 三. Eureka 客户端开 ...
- 【五】分布式微服务架构体系详解——服务发现和服务通信
前言 微服务架构的概念比容器技术早,但是却随着容器技术在13年的兴起,基于容器技术的微服务架构越来越被广泛应用.容器的轻量级部署方式很适合为每个微服务提供基础运行环境. 本文会基于Docker容器,先 ...
- 【学习笔记】consul注册中心,服务注册、服务发现、服务监控笔记
consul api kv - Key/Value存储 agent - Agent控制,一般用来服务注册和检查注册 catalog - 管理nodes和services health - 管理健康监测 ...
- Node ZooKeeper 服务发现获取服务节点信息并发送请求
公司服务治理需通过 ZK 来做服务发现,Java都被集成,有封装好的包,直接注释器调用即可.Node还需自己手搓. 1. node-zookeeper-client 包连接 ZK 官方文档:https ...
- 服务治理,服务发现,服务注册
什么是服务治理? 那就谈谈为什么要服务治理,是哪方面的需要才出现这个操作的.当我们服务于服务之间通讯调用的时候,我们前期的话就是简单粗暴的用httpclient去请求,没经过第三方的组件管理,然后访问 ...
- python consul服务发现_consule服务注册和发现 安装 部署
安装部署参考 api连接参考 端口介绍 8500,客户端http api接口 8600,客户端DNS服务端口 8400,客户端RPC通信端口 8300,集群server RPC通信接口 8301,集群 ...
- 删除服务 MySQL mysql删除服务 无法删除服务
在电脑小娜输入框中输入cmd->以管理员身份运行 2.右键我的电脑->管理->服务->找到要删除的服务->右键属性 复制服务名称 3.输入 命令 sc delete 服务 ...
最新文章
- OpenCV计算机视觉编程攻略之生成椒盐噪声实现
- 通俗易懂地解决中文乱码问题(2) --- 分析解决Mysql插入移动端表情符报错 ‘incorrect string value: '\xF0......
- 网上有打印按键怎么设置下载_打印机共享怎么设置 如何设置打印机共享【详细攻略】...
- C语言分区排序partition sort 算法(附完整源码)
- java用十字链表实现无向图_实验四:图的实现与应用
- [css] 请说说*{box-sizing: border-box;}的作用及好处有哪些?
- NSHashTable and NSMapTable
- 今天的绿得像碧玉的 飞鸽
- 登陆代码 寻找更好的
- hadoop 替代方案_如何通过比较替代方案做出有效的决定
- MATLAB 四元数旋转函数
- PyTorch绘制训练过程的accuracy和loss曲线
- 交换机的源地址学习机制和帧转发方式习题
- ALtera DE2开发板学习04
- 爬虫教程( 6 ) --- 爬虫 进阶、扩展
- 查看视频文件格式信息的工具--MediaInfo
- java源码之 io 流源码解读(一)
- java 走马灯程序_微信小程序实现简单跑马灯效果
- Android中自定义RatingBar实现星星大小,数量,间距等的设置
- 我为什么选择鲸交所WhaleEx?
热门文章
- 数据结构一些常见术语的中英文对照
- 算法——排序——归并排序图解动画
- 计算机创业计划书800字大全,创业计划书范文800字
- ffmpeg源码国内gitee下载
- html 360浏览器表单自动填写,360 浏览器自动填表: 让重复填表见鬼去
- ati自定义分辨率_Windows的自定义显示分辨率实用程序
- 非模式对话框CreateDialog() 与 模式对话框 DialogBoxParam()和DialogBox()
- 正方教务管理系统服务器崩溃,正方教务管理系统应用中存在的问题及应对策略...
- 【大话数据结构-数据结构绪论①】
- 压缩解压缩工具之WinRAR